The Center for Women’s Business Research, in collaboration with Babson College, will be in Dallas, TX on September 20, 2007 at the Westin Dallas/Fort Worth Airport hotel for the fourth Accelerating the Growth of Businesses Owned by Women of Color research forum!

The Center’s multi-year research effort engages women of color entrepreneurs in a dialogue about the factors that are preventing them from growing their businesses, and the actions that are necessary to meet and overcome those barriers.
Want to attend/participate? Be sure you qualify:
- Asian, Latina, African-American & other multi-ethnic women
- Own 50% or more of a business
- Have been in business three or more years
- Have annual revenues between $250,000 and $5 million
- Want to grow their business beyond their current level
